Skip to content

Instantly share code, notes, and snippets.

@peterjwest
Created September 13, 2012 09:16
Show Gist options
  • Save peterjwest/3713112 to your computer and use it in GitHub Desktop.
Save peterjwest/3713112 to your computer and use it in GitHub Desktop.
Mandango embedded woes
public function setSegments($segments)
{
$mandango = $this->getMandango();
$segments = array_map(function($name) use ($mandango) {
return $mandango->create('Model\Intervention\InterventionSetSegment')->setName($name);
}, $segments);
$segmentGroup = parent::getSegments();
$segmentGroup->remove($segmentGroup->all());
$this->save();
$segmentGroup->add($segments);
return $this;
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ment